Brunson's Bold Financial Move Shows Commitment to Knicks

New York Knicks All-NBA guard Jalen Brunson has made a significant financial decision that highlights his dedication to the team's triumph. Brunson has consented to a four-year, $156.5 million contract extension with the Knicks, which is $113 million less than what he could have pocketed if he had held on until next year's free agency. This unprecedented step proves Brunson's goal to make the most of his prime years with the Knicks and develop a roster capable of contending for a championship.

Opting for a Smaller Contract: A Strategic Move

By agreeing to a smaller contract, Brunson allows the Knicks to preserve roster flexibility and make future moves to bolster the team. His decision protects the Knicks from reaching the second-apron level of the salary cap, which restricts their ability to make trades, sign players, and use draft picks. Brunson's knowledge of championship organizations and star players who designed contracts for team success, such as Patrick Mahomes and Tom Brady, influenced his decision.

Brunson's Impactful Arrival and Evolution

Brunson's arrival to the Knicks two years ago has been transformative. He has morphed into one of the NBA's most influential players and leaders, earning All-NBA honors and finishing in the top five of the MVP voting in the 2023-24 season. Brunson's decision to prioritize the team's success over personal financial gain manifests his deep faith in the organization and his ambition to chase a championship with the Knicks.

A Talented Ensemble and Strong Connections

The Knicks have paired Brunson with a gifted ensemble of his former Villanova teammates, creating a notable synchronicity on and off the court. The team's president of basketball operations, Leon Rose, was also Brunson's agent before joining the Knicks. Moreover, Brunson's father, Rick, serves as a Knicks assistant coach. These connections underline Brunson's commitment to the franchise and his confidence in its potential for success.

Emulating the Trend Set by MVP-Level Players

Brunson's decision to take a noteworthy pay cut follows a pattern established by other MVP-level players in various sports. Players like Tim Duncan, Kevin Durant, and LeBron James have previously structured contracts to give their teams the best shot at sustainable title runs. Brunson's readiness to sacrifice financial gains underscores his dedication to the Knicks' long-term success.

Risk and Potential Recoupment

While there is an inherent risk in postponing his most lucrative paydays, Brunson's emphasis remains on maximizing his career's prime with the Knicks. He acknowledges the importance of a talented and deep roster in closing the gap on a championship. By signing this contract extension, Brunson positions himself for the potential to recoup the $113 million he forfeited on a future maximum extension in 2028 or 2029.
